Rochester Community Schools Accepting Limited School of Choice Applications

High School students who reside in an Oakland
County Intermediate School District who do not reside within the Rochester Community Schools district boundaries have the opportunity to apply to attend
Rochester’s Alternative Center for Education (ACE), located at 1440 John R Rd., Rochester Hills, for the second semester which begins on January 22, 2013.

There will be 3 seat time waiver openings, and 3
traditional openings at the ACE facility only. Parents who are interested in applying to have their nonresident child
attend Rochester’s Alternative Educational Center, please follow the application procedures below:

Applications will be accepted during the application period, December 17th through January 11, 2013.  Applications will not be available prior to
the start date or after January 11th.

Applications will be available at the office of Student Enrollment, located in the Rochester Administration
Building, 501 West University Drive.  Office hours are Monday through Friday, 7:30-4:00.

Applications will be reviewed for accurate information.  This may involve contacting the student’s current school.

The district must accept eligible applicants (Section 105 of the State School Aid Act MCL 388.1705). Students
will be selected according to a random draw system.

Student’s acceptance is conditional based on review of student’s record of discipline, suspensions, and expulsions.

Parents are responsible for transportation of students to and from school.

Notification will be mailed to parents via US mail January 16, 2013.
